# Signing — VramScope builds

VramScope GPU memory profiler artifacts require signatures before publishing to the Holloway registry. Build with the standard target, then sign the wheel and the CLI binary. Unsigned artifacts fail registry checks. CI handles production signing; for dev builds, use the contractor signing key below.

rollout seal: bky9_PeXH1fTLY

Drivers: 11% lower per-pallet cost, better cold-chain coverage in the eastern corridor, penalty clauses for missed windows. One-off transition cost estimated at mid six figures, recovered within fourteen months. Risks: dual-running costs in months two and three, warehouse system integration. Mitigation owned by operations. Finance to model cash impact by month-end and confirm accrual treatment. A confidential note on related plans follows.

board note of tadup-tajog: Headcount on the Oliiel team goes from 31 to 88 by the end of February. Gross margin on Oliiel came in at 62 percent against a plan of 29 percent.

### Step 4: Configure tailstream access

Before your plugin can attach to the Quillhose log tailer, verify the CLI version with `quillhose --version` (must be 2.3 or newer). Plugins connect through the broker socket, not directly to log shards, so network access to the shard hosts is unnecessary. The broker authenticates each session using a token read from your local `.env`. Append this line to that file now.

env line for fafof-fahag: LEDGER_TOKEN5=f8790

## Formula sandbox tuning

User-supplied formulas in Gridmoor execute inside a restricted interpreter with hard ceilings on time, memory, and call depth. Reviewers should confirm any change to these ceilings is justified in the PR description, since raising them widens the abuse surface. Defaults were chosen from production traces. The current limits are as follows.

limits module of tafog-fawip:
WEIGHTS = {
    "julix": 57,
    "lamys": 992,
    "kasvan": 209,
    "quenok": 750,
    "alddor": 259,
    "oliath": 1009,
    "wenix": 815,
}